Age Of Wonders
(cube) 08:40 AM CET - Nov,14 1999

Age Of Wonders is turn-based fantasy strategy game taking place at land of the ancient races. Each of the races (Human, Elves, Undead, Dwarves, Orcs and others) has it's own specific units with different characteristics. What I really appreciate is, that the races are well balanced, for example human units are weaker than the other races' ones but they're build faster. it is possible to upgrade every town/castle but only to the particular level, which makes you build the strongest units at capitols but also you must defend well the border towns. There are special air / fire / water nodes which can be used to cast deadly spells, so they're subject of all-time battles.

Another really cool thing on AOW is that there are two ways to fight particular battle. The first is 'do it fast' way, where all the participating units appear in special slots on the screens and strike each against other ones. You can skip to the end of the battle by pressing one button, so you really don't need to watch all the animations and battle is finished in few seconds. The second possibility is slow, but great for the people who want to have control over as much as possible. It's like the all units move to the small world showing the place where the battle takes place, and now here you can control every unit separately, like in Civilization game, but this way of battling takes a couple of minutes.

Age Of Wonders is not breakthrough title, but it pushes the aspects of turn-based strategy playing to the limit. In the pack you will find one big campaign consisting of several continual scenarios, or you can select one from many single scenarios playable on single computer, or as a multiplayer match on IPX or TCP/IP (Internet).



snd: 5/5 - There is a nice music playing in the background and audio samples played while moving, spelling or fighting are great as well.
gfx: 5/5 - Wonderful. The game can run in any of supported resolutions, anyway, in higher ones it gets very slow.
playability: 5/5 - A must have for every TBS player.
